Atomic Paint Shop, Inc.

Mike Nichols, PhD

Capabilities:

APS’ business is depositing polymer coatings by unique plasma CVD methods for highly controllable chemistry and superb adhesion of conformal coatings on a broad range of substrates at low temperature.

  • Type of work: chemical synthesis of unique materials for conformal application of adherent, lubricious, durable and media resistant coatings.
  • Technical areas: specialty chemicals, polymer thin films, electronic coatings, industrial harsh-environment sensors, personal care product coatings for lubrication, corrosion protection and color enhancement.

Background:

  • President/Founder Atomic Paint Shop, Columbia, MO
  • President/Founder Nichols Technologies, Columbia, MO
  • Education: PhD, Biomedical Engineering Sciences/Mathematics, U. Missouri

Some representative projects:

  • Mike participated in the early days of sensor development in the invention of the first solid state pH electrode (for which he received a patent in 1982).
  • Development of PlasmaleneTM coated sensors
  • Development of stable, adherent membrane for protection of gold and platinum oxygen sensors and biogalvanic batteries (patents, 1981, 1983)
  • Novel continuous feed plasma enhanced chemical vapor deposition (PECVD) reactor (patented 1993).
  • Plasma synthesized coatings for hermetic sealing of integrated circuits for implantable devices, such as the total artificial heart (TAH) program, for NIH.
